What Features Distinguish the Best Adidas Backpacks?

The best Adidas backpacks are distinguished by their quality, functionality, and design features that cater to various needs.

  • Durability: High-quality materials such as polyester and nylon are often used in the construction of Adidas backpacks, ensuring they can withstand daily wear and tear. Reinforced stitching and robust zippers further enhance their longevity, making them suitable for both casual and rigorous use.
  • Comfort: Many Adidas backpacks feature padded shoulder straps and back panels, which provide comfort during prolonged use. Adjustable straps allow for a customizable fit, reducing strain on the shoulders and back, making them ideal for students or travelers who carry heavy loads.
  • Storage Capacity: The best Adidas backpacks come with multiple compartments and pockets, allowing for organized storage of essentials. Larger models often include dedicated laptop sleeves, side mesh pockets for water bottles, and front zippered pockets for easy access to smaller items.
  • Style and Design: Adidas backpacks are known for their stylish designs, often reflecting the brand’s iconic look with bold logos and color schemes. This aesthetic appeal makes them versatile for various occasions, whether for school, gym, or casual outings.
  • Features and Functionality: Many models include additional features such as water-resistant materials, reflective details for safety during low-light conditions, and even USB charging ports for convenience. Such features enhance their usability for modern lifestyles, making them more than just a simple backpack.

Which Materials Enhance Durability in Adidas Backpacks?

The materials that enhance durability in Adidas backpacks include:

  • Polyester: This synthetic fabric is widely used in Adidas backpacks due to its resistance to tears and abrasions. It is lightweight, water-resistant, and maintains its shape well, making it ideal for everyday use and various weather conditions.
  • Nylon: Known for its strength and durability, nylon is often employed in the construction of Adidas backpacks. It offers excellent resistance to wear and tear, is water-repellent, and can handle heavy loads without easily stretching or breaking.
  • Ripstop Fabric: This is a special weave pattern that adds strength and prevents tearing. Used in high-performance Adidas backpacks, ripstop fabric combines lightweight properties with enhanced durability, ensuring that the backpack can withstand rigorous activities.
  • TPU Coating: Th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) coating is often applied to fabrics for added waterproofing and abrasion resistance. This coating helps protect the backpack from moisture and wear, extending its lifespan, especially in harsh outdoor conditions.
  • Reinforced Stitching: While not a material itself, reinforced stitching is crucial in enhancing a backpack’s durability. It involves using stronger threads and additional stitching techniques at stress points, minimizing the risk of seams ripping or coming apart under pressure.
